Output 85e4081c53451a47496c37b5d762719ac463a29c6cd9dcde53068b2d14418137:2

value
8577418
script pubkey
OP_0 OP_PUSHBYTES_20 20aa5f3f90552d90fb132d41b6226698fa5b4f1a
address
ltc1qyz4970us25kep7cn94qmvgnxnra9knc63v2ejn
transaction
85e4081c53451a47496c37b5d762719ac463a29c6cd9dcde53068b2d14418137
spent
true